| Definition | título da dívida pública pagável ao portador | embarcação de pequenas dimensões, fabricada de madeira, alumínio, borracha ou fibra de vidro, movida a remo ou a vela |

A purely visual mix-up. bonde (/ˈbõⁿ.ʤɪ/) and bote (/ˈbɔti/) are said differently, so reading them aloud is the quickest way to catch the wrong one.
